Raising Resilient Children: A Parent’s Blueprint for Wise Parenting

The Importance of Raising Resilient Children===

As parents, our ultimate goal is to raise children who are capable of thriving in the world. We want our children to be strong, independent, and confident, able to handle whatever challenges life throws their way. One of the most important traits we can instill in our kids is resilience, the ability to bounce back from adversity and to keep moving forward.

Resilience is not something that comes naturally to every child, but it can be learned and practiced through wise parenting. In this article, we will explore ways to build resilience in our children, and offer tips and strategies for nurturing this essential quality. By following these guidelines, parents can help their children face life’s obstacles with courage, determination, and grace.

Building Resilience in Children: A Step-by-Step Guide

Building resilience in children is a gradual process that involves patience, persistence, and love. Here are some key steps parents can take to help their children develop this essential quality:

  1. Model resilience: Children learn by example, so parents who demonstrate resilience in their own lives are more likely to raise resilient kids. Be open about your own struggles and how you overcome them. Show your children how to handle disappointment, setbacks, and challenges with grace and determination.

  2. Encourage risk-taking: One of the best ways to build resilience in children is to encourage them to take risks and try new things. Whether it’s trying a new sport, making a new friend, or tackling a difficult project, taking risks helps kids learn that failure is not the end of the world.

  3. Foster a growth mindset: Children who believe that their abilities can grow and improve through hard work and effort are more likely to be resilient when faced with challenges. Encourage your kids to embrace a growth mindset by praising their effort and persistence, rather than their innate talents.

  4. Provide a supportive environment: Children who feel loved, supported, and accepted are more likely to be resilient. Make sure your children know that you are always there for them, no matter what. Create a home environment that is safe and nurturing, and surround your kids with positive role models.

Nurturing Resilience: Essential Parenting Strategies

In addition to the above steps, there are several essential parenting strategies that can help nurture resilience in children:

  1. Build strong relationships: Strong relationships with parents, siblings, and peers can provide a foundation of emotional strength that helps children weather life’s storms. Encourage your children to build positive relationships with others, and model healthy relationship behaviors yourself.

  2. Foster problem-solving skills: Children who are good problem solvers are better equipped to handle challenges and setbacks. Encourage your kids to brainstorm solutions to problems, and help them learn to think creatively and flexibly.

  3. Teach emotional regulation: Learning to regulate emotions is an important part of resilience. Teach your children techniques for managing difficult emotions, such as deep breathing, mindfulness, and self-talk.

  4. Encourage self-care: Resilience requires physical and emotional strength, so it’s important to encourage your children to take care of themselves. Teach your kids healthy habits, such as exercise, good nutrition, and adequate sleep.

Overcoming Obstacles: How to Help Your Child Bounce Back from Adversity

Despite our best efforts to build resilience in our children, they will inevitably face challenges and setbacks in life. Here are some strategies parents can use to help their kids bounce back from adversity:

  1. Validate their feelings: When your child experiences a setback, it’s important to acknowledge their feelings and help them process their emotions. Let them know that you understand how they feel, and that it’s okay to be upset.

  2. Help them reframe the situation: Encourage your child to look at the situation from a different perspective. Help them find the silver lining, and focus on what they can learn from the experience.

  3. Provide support and encouragement: Let your child know that you are there for them, and that you believe in their ability to overcome the challenge. Offer words of encouragement and praise their efforts, even if they don’t succeed right away.

  4. Help them problem-solve: Work with your child to come up with a plan for how to handle the situation. Encourage them to brainstorm solutions and help them evaluate the pros and cons of each option.
